The school bus endorsement applies to applicants who wish to drive a school bus in any Class A or B CDL. To add an S endorsement to your CLP/CDL, you must pass the Texas school bus test, and you must also pass skills tests in a school bus. The TX CDL bus test consists of 20 questions, and you'll need at least 16 correct answers to pass (80%). The knowledge test covers the following sections of the Texas CDL Manual: School Buses, Vehicle Inspection Test, Basic Control Skills Test and Road Test.
